Nick Young Unlikely To Return To Lakers 

Post#1 » by RealGM Wiretap » Mon Jul 4, 2016 2:49 am

The Los Angeles Lakers are expected to trade or waive Nick Young before the start of training camp.


Young has two more seasons remaining on his contract totaling $11 million.


Young averaged 7.3 points on a career low True Shooting Percentage of .483 in 19.1 minutes per game this past season.


Young just turned 31 and he had an off-court issue with D'Angelo Russell, who was the Lakers' No. 2 overall pick in 2015.

Via Mike Bresnahan/Los Angeles Times
